SiPix A6 Mobile Pocket Printer 29.99 overstock

Specifications:

Printing method: [b]thermal[/b] :crooked:
Maximum resolution: 400 DPI
Maximum print size: 4-1/8-inches wide
Interface: infrared, serial
Systems supported: Microsoft Windows CE 2.0-3.1, Windows 98/98SE/ Me/2000/XP, Palm OS

Accessories include:

RS-232 serial printer cable
One roll A6 printer paper
Four AA batteries
AC power adapter
Travel Bag
I/S complete IrPrint application software

Warranty: 1 year limited - manufacturer
Materials: Plastic. metal, electrical components
Model No: A6
Dimensions: 4.3 in. x 5.9 in. x 1 in.

Here is a disconcerting review on Amazon.com....

"May be great for Palm or laptop, Lousy for Pocket PC....., January 4, 2003
Reviewer: Dan Kennedy (see more about me) from Lexington, KY USA
Will not work with the new Dell Axim or most 2002 version of Pocket PC. Sipix has said "They are working on the problem" for at least a year that I know of. How hard would it be to write a driver for these handhelds? Tech support refuses to reply by e-mail and only by phone which takes 45 minutes to connect. Works OK with laptop and other than the paper only lasts for 20 printouts per roll and the curl is hard to get out it works good. "
